Beautiful Historic Home Masterfully Updated – minutes from downtown Bradenton; Step back in time to 1842 when Josiah Gates, the first Anglo-American settler from Tampa, purchased 74 acres and operated the state’s largest mango and grapefruit plantation. This was one of the homes on the estate and has been lovingly cared for and updated over the years. This lovely lady has withstood the winds and rain and has remained high and dry; a testament to the craftsmanship of bygone days. The home retains the original Heart Pine flooring, plaster walls and detailed millwork throughout. Modern updates include a gourmet kitchen with NEW Forno refrigerator and dishwasher as well as a NEW allman Classico dual-fuel range offering the best of both worlds, gas stove top cooking and electric convection oven. The family room boasts an electric fireplace with a mantle from the 1800s. The dining area sparkles under an antique crystal chandelier, also from the 1800s. The screened in front porch takes you back in time where you can relax with a glass of sweet tea and read on the swing. Modern day updates include: METAL ROOF (2018), AC handler and hot water heater (2021), NEW electric panel and raised mast (2024), NEW hot tub and 50 amp outlet for an RV (2024), NEW washer and dryer (2024) conveniently located on the 2nd floor near bedrooms, 4 NEW (2024) hurricane impact windows upstairs. The Home has also been freshly painted inside and out. The neighborhood, composed of full-time residents, offers views of the Manatee River with the River Walk 3 blocks away.
